1999 State of Wyoming 99LSO-0317



                              HOUSE BILL NO. HB0151
                                        
                                        
Special license plates for firemen.

Sponsored by: Representative(s) McOmie, Badgett, Diercks,
              Law, Philp, Robinson and Rose, J. and
              Senator(s) Case, Harris and Peck


                                     A BILL
                                        
                                       for

 1  AN ACT relating to motor vehicle license plates; authorizing

 2  special license plates to be issued to firemen; specifying

 3  requirements; and providing for an effective date.

 4

 5  Be It Enacted by the Legislature of the State of Wyoming:

 6

 7       Section 1.  W.S. 31-2-218 is created to read:

 8     

 9       31-2-218.  Firemen's license plates.

10

11  (a)  A fireman employed by a city or duly created fire

12  protection district, a volunteer fireman as defined by W.S.

13  35-9-601(a)(i) or a retired firefighter may apply for

14  distinctive license plates for any motor vehicle owned by

15  him upon registration of the vehicle.  These license plates

16  shall be displayed upon the vehicle for which they are

 1  issued. The license plates shall bear a distinctive symbol

 2  and letters identifying the registrant as a fireman.

 3

 4       (b)  Application for license plates under subsection

 5  (a) of this section shall be annually made to the county

 6  treasurer as provided by W.S. 31-2-201. Application forms

 7  shall be available at all county treasurer's offices. The

 8  normal registration fees and the fee required under W.S.

 9  31-3-102(a)(viii) shall accompany each application.

10

11       (c)  All applications for special license plates

12  provided by this section shall be made directly to the

13  county treasurer at least thirty (30) days before

14  registration of the vehicle expires.  The department may

15  prepare any special forms and issue any rules and

16  regulations necessary to carry out this section.

17

18       Section 2.  This act is effective January 1, 2000.
